Yes, I'm aware of that but clavardage sounded better to me than chat. Here in Quebec, French is almost assimilated so we have to fight for it. I was just trying to avoid untranslated words or confusing words ( "chat" means cat in French too for those who didn't know). I think clavardage, even though it was coined in Quebec, is much more truthful to French origins than "chat" which has no French roots at all.
For Devs, Clavardage is coined by mixing "clavier" (keyboard) + "bavardage" (chat) = French roots.
I had a long time to think about it when translating the game, and I still stand by my decision, the rest is up to devs.
If you guys want to remove clavardage, I suggest "bavardage" because the way things go, why translate it to French at all if we're going to use English expressions?
